The video is a week‑in‑the‑life vlog of a mother pregnant with her fifth child, chronicling a massive Costco grocery run, family routines, and the emotional roller‑coaster of a busy household. She walks viewers through a $1,000 bulk haul of organic staples, pull‑ups for upcoming potty training, and a simple Korean‑inspired beef bowl, while also sharing moments of prayer and early‑morning reflection. Key insights include the strain of soaring Canadian grocery prices, the reliance on subscription‑based educational kits like KiwiCo to keep children engaged, and the unpredictable challenges of pregnancy‑related mood swings. The vlog also highlights an unexpected camera lens break that was resolved with a $1,000 discount, underscoring the importance of quick problem‑solving and cost‑saving measures. Notable moments feature the narrator saying, “We spent nearly $1,000 at Costco,” and promoting a KiwiCo discount code that offers 50% off the first crate. She also recounts a mental breakdown triggered by hormonal shifts, describing how prayer and a quiet morning reset helped her regain composure. These details illustrate how growing families juggle rising living costs, educational needs, mental‑health pressures, and unexpected expenses.
